Third Round Highlights
Eilidh Barbour presents highlights of the third round of the Scottish Open.
Rory McIlroy is the headline act in a stellar field in Dundonald which also includes Open champion Henrik Stenson and 2013 Masters champion Adam Scott.
McIlroy has endured an injury-disrupted season due to a rib problem and the four-time major winner is keen to find some form in a Dundonald field which also includes 2016 champion Alex Noren.
The Swede beat England's Tyrrell Hatton by one stroke at Castle Stuart - ending the tournament on 14 under after a two-under-par 70 in his final round.

Final Round Highlights
Eilidh Barbour presents highlights of the fourth and final round of the Scottish Open from Dundonald.
This time 12 months ago, Sweden's Alex Noren was celebrating on the final day - beating England's Tyrrell Hatton by one stroke at Castle Stuart.
Noren ended the tournament on 14 under after a two-under-par 70 final round and is joined in Scotland this year by four-time major winner Rory McIlroy and Open champion Henrik Stenson.

Murdoch Mysteries
Set in Toronto at the dawn of the 20th century, Murdoch Mysteries is a one-hour drama series that explores the intriguing world of William Murdoch, a methodical and dashing detective who pioneers innovative forensic techniques to solve some of the city's most gruesome murders. Murdoch's colleagues include the love of his life, coroner and psychiatrist Dr. Julia Ogden, a staunch ally who shares the detective's fascination for science; Constable George Crabtree, Murdoch's eager but sometimes naïve right-hand man; Inspector Brackenreid, Murdoch's skeptical yet reluctantly supportive boss; and coroner Dr. Emily Grace, Dr. Ogden's protégé.

Irish Blood
Irish Blood focuses on Fiona, whose path in life is earmarked by her father, Declan, who seemingly abandoned her and her mother on her tenth birthday. After years of channelling anger toward him, to the benefit of her litigious clients, a message from her father sends her to Ireland. There she learns key truths about her father as well as a family that doesn't know she exists, and, moreover, that the story of abandonment that has shaped her entire life - was a lie. A lie intended to protect her and her mother from her father's shady business dealings. Fiona resolves to uncover the full truth about her father and reconnect with the parent she only thought she knew.
